Spring Maintenance

Spring is a crucial time for garden maintenance in Plaistow. As the weather warms up, it’s essential to prepare your garden for the growing season.

Tasks to Perform:

  • Clear out winter debris and fallen leaves.
  • Prune flowering shrubs and trees to encourage new growth.
  • Test soil pH and amend with compost if necessary.
  • Start planting early spring vegetables and annuals.

Summer Maintenance

Summer in Plaistow can be quite warm, making it essential to focus on watering and pest control.

Key Focus Areas:

  1. Regularly water plants, especially during dry spells.
  2. Mulch garden beds to retain moisture and suppress weeds.
  3. Monitor for pests and diseases, applying organic treatments as needed.
  4. Deadhead spent flowers to promote continuous blooming.

Fall Preparation

As temperatures drop, preparing your garden for the winter months is essential to ensure plants survive the cold.

Essential Fall Tasks:

  • Plant cover crops to enrich the soil.
  • Rake and compost fallen leaves.
  • Protect tender plants with mulch or frost covers.
  • Prune perennials and divide overcrowded plants.

Winter Care

Winter requires minimal maintenance, but some tasks can help your garden recover and thrive in the following spring.

Winter Maintenance Tips:

  1. Inspect garden structures and repair any damage.
  2. Continue watering evergreen plants during dry periods.
  3. Plan your garden layout and order seeds for the next season.
  4. Protect vulnerable plants from extreme weather conditions.

Climate Considerations

Plaistow’s climate plays a significant role in determining which plants will thrive in your garden. Understanding the local weather patterns helps in selecting resilient and appropriate plant species.

Recommended Plants:

  • Perennials like lavender and echinacea.
  • Shade-tolerant plants such as hostas and ferns.
  • Drought-resistant varieties including succulents and ornamental grasses.
  • Seasonal flowers like tulips and daffodils for spring color.

Soil Health

The soil in Plaistow can vary, so testing and amending your soil is crucial for optimal plant growth.

Improving Soil Quality:

  1. Incorporate organic matter like compost and manure.
  2. Use mulches to enhance soil structure and fertility.
  3. Rotate crops to prevent soil depletion and reduce pests.
  4. Adjust pH levels based on plant requirements.

Essential Tools

Having the right tools can make garden maintenance in Plaistow more efficient and enjoyable.

Must-Have Equipment:

  • Pruning shears for trimming plants and shaping shrubs.
  • Garden gloves to protect your hands from thorns and dirt.
  • Spade and fork for digging and aerating the soil.
  • Hose and watering can for proper irrigation.

Advanced Tools

For more intricate gardening tasks, considering advanced tools can enhance your maintenance routine.

Advanced Equipment:

  1. Lawn mower for maintaining grassy areas.
  2. Rototiller for preparing large garden beds.
  3. Chainsaw for handling larger branches and trees.
  4. Compost bin to recycle garden waste efficiently.
